舍得酒业携手京东发布低酒度畅饮型老酒“舍得自在”
Bei Jing Shang Bao· 2025-09-01 04:28
Group 1 - The core product "Shede Zizai" was launched at a retail price of 329 yuan, featuring a blend of 6-year base liquor, 20-year flavored liquor, and 30-year premium flavored liquor with an alcohol content of 29 degrees [1] - The launch event included a strategic partnership signing between Shede Liquor and JD Group, aiming to leverage JD's marketing capabilities to reach a vast target audience [1] - Shede Liquor's president emphasized the product's high cost-performance ratio, rich flavor, and appealing design, positioning it as a response to consumer demand for high-quality low-alcohol aged liquor [1] Group 2 - The chairman of the China Alcoholic Drinks Association highlighted the unique "time value" of Chinese liquor, which includes rare aged value, complex flavors, and deep cultural significance [2] - The product "Shede Zizai" is designed to evoke a sense of ease and comfort, balancing low alcohol content with the smoothness of aged flavors, indicating a response to evolving consumer preferences [2] - The collaboration with JD is seen as an innovative practice that merges traditional brewing wisdom with modern distribution efficiency [2]

6年基酒、定价329元,“舍得自在”以“高质价比”切入新消费赛道
Sou Hu Wang· 2025-08-31 07:32
Core Viewpoint - The launch of "Shede Zizai," a low-alcohol drinking type aged liquor, has generated significant industry interest and is positioned to meet new consumer demands for lighter, more enjoyable drinking experiences [2][4][21]. Product Information - "Shede Zizai" is a 29-degree liquor with a net content of 500ml, priced at 329 yuan per bottle, emphasizing "light burden, more mellow" [2][10]. - The product features a modern design that combines traditional Eastern aesthetics with a minimalist style, appealing to younger consumers [6][10]. Quality and Innovation - The liquor is based on a 6-year aged base liquor, complemented by 20 and 30-year aged liquors, ensuring a rich flavor profile [8][10]. - Three core technologies have been employed to maintain flavor integrity at a lower alcohol content, ensuring a high-quality drinking experience [8][9]. Market Strategy - The partnership with JD.com aims to leverage its extensive user base and marketing capabilities to reach target consumers effectively [17][18]. - The product is expected to tap into the growing market of younger consumers, particularly those under 30, who are increasingly seeking quality and value in their purchases [18][21]. Industry Context - The launch reflects a broader trend in the liquor industry towards lower alcohol content and innovative product offerings to meet changing consumer preferences [21][27]. - "Shede Zizai" is seen as a strategic move for Shede Liquor to expand its product matrix and explore new consumption demands [15][27].
宽窄研究院酒业半年报探析:头部分化明显行业共同承压,产品创新渠道变革细分赛道成为破局点
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-08-30 14:48
Core Viewpoint - The Chinese liquor industry is undergoing a deep adjustment period, facing challenges such as production contraction, consumption differentiation, and weak terminal sales, leading to a shift from rapid growth to declining production and sales profits [1] Industry Overview - The release of half-year reports from listed liquor companies indicates a significant change in the industry, with increased sales expenses and fierce competition among well-known brands for first-tier markets [1][12] - The overall profitability of the industry is declining, with many companies experiencing double-digit declines in revenue and profit, alongside rising inventory pressures and deteriorating product liquidity [11] Company Performance - Guizhou Moutai reported a total revenue of 91.094 billion, a year-on-year increase of 9.16%, and a net profit of 45.403 billion, up 8.89% [3] - Wuliangye achieved a revenue of 52.771 billion, growing 4.19%, and a net profit of 19.492 billion, up 2.28% [3] - Shanxi Fenjiu's revenue reached 23.964 billion, a 5.35% increase, with a net profit of 8.505 billion, up 1.13% [3] - Luzhou Laojiao reported a revenue of 16.454 billion, down 2.67%, and a net profit of 7.663 billion, down 4.54% [5] - Yanghe's revenue was 14.796 billion, down 35.32%, with a net profit of 4.344 billion, down 45.34% [5] - Other companies like Water Well and Shede also reported significant declines in revenue and profit, indicating the widespread impact of the industry's challenges [5][6][7] Market Trends - The industry is seeing a shift towards product innovation and channel transformation, with companies launching lower-alcohol and light bottle products to attract younger consumers [12][13] - The market is characterized by a need for companies to adapt to changing consumer preferences and enhance brand influence and channel efficiency [7][12] - Analysts suggest that the current environment is not isolated, and the liquor industry will eventually recover as consumption and the economy improve [13]

白酒强势反攻涨超2%,形势看似一片大好,背后真相真有这么简单?
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-08-30 02:06
Core Viewpoint - The white liquor sector has shown a remarkable upward trend, with the index rising over 2%, driven by significant stock performances from companies like Jinhui Liquor and Shede Liquor, despite underlying inventory pressures that equate to 3 to 6 months of sales [1][2][4]. Market Performance - On August 29, the white liquor stocks surged, with the Tonghuashun white liquor index surpassing a 2% increase. Jinhui Liquor led with over a 6% rise, while Shede Liquor and Gujing Gongjiu followed with increases of over 4% [2]. - Major brands like Guizhou Moutai also demonstrated resilience, with a 1.36% increase, maintaining a strong position above the 1,000 yuan mark [2]. Fund Movements - Central Huijin, representing the "national team," significantly increased its holdings in the white liquor ETF by 121 million shares in the first half of the year, raising its total to 581 million shares, making it the third-largest holder of this ETF [4]. - The overall market performance in August saw the Tonghuashun white liquor index accumulate a rise of over 13% [4]. Valuation and Policy Support - The current price-to-earnings (PE) ratio for the white liquor sector stands at 19.83, marking a near ten-year low, with individual companies like Guizhou Moutai at a dynamic PE of 24 and Wuliangye at 17, both below historical averages, indicating significant valuation appeal [6]. - Recent government policies aimed at stimulating consumption and addressing unreasonable restrictions on the liquor industry have provided positive signals for the market [6]. Fundamental Improvements and Seasonal Recovery - There are signs of marginal improvement in the fundamentals, particularly with the recovery of banquet and gift consumption since late July, especially in the sub-300 yuan price range [7]. - The upcoming Mid-Autumn Festival and National Day are expected to catalyze demand, enhancing sales momentum [7]. Changing Fund Preferences and Shareholder Returns - Fund preferences are shifting as leading liquor companies increase dividend rates and implement stock buybacks, with dividend yields for major firms exceeding 3.5%, appealing to long-term investors seeking stable returns [10]. Ongoing Challenges - Despite positive market signals, underlying issues such as weak consumer spending persist, with a reported 2.1% year-on-year growth in per capita consumption expenditure in Q1 2025, impacting sales, particularly in high-end products [11]. - Inventory levels remain a significant challenge, with some mainstream brands holding stock equivalent to 3 to 6 months of normal sales, and production figures showing a 5.8% decline year-on-year [11]. - Price discrepancies continue, with major products like Wuliangye's mainstream offerings trading at 12.5% below factory prices, affecting profit margins for distributors [12]. Institutional Perspectives and Future Outlook - Market consensus among institutions shows a belief in a gradual recovery for the white liquor industry, with improved sales and pricing indicators suggesting potential for recovery [13]. - If sales data during the Mid-Autumn Festival exceeds expectations, the mid-range liquor segment may experience a rebound [15]. - Long-term prospects remain strong due to the robust business models of leading companies, although economic stabilization and inventory reduction will take time to materialize [15].

舍得酒业(600702):2025年秋季策略会速递-精细化经营 静待需求恢复
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2025-08-29 09:02
Core Insights - The company emphasizes long-termism and focuses on channel health and inventory reduction, maintaining a positive fundamental trend and stable operations as it enters the second half of 2025 [1] Product Performance - In the first half of the year, the company faced external challenges leading to a contraction in business consumption demand, but it achieved its expected targets. The product structure saw minimal changes, with core products focusing on business consumption facing pressure, while mass-market products like Shezhidao and the bottle wine brand T68 showed significant growth [2] - The company continues to pursue high-end product development and has seen substantial growth in its collectible series, with a notable increase in the first half of 2025 due to a low base [2] Channel Strategy - The company enhances sales through platform push and consumer pull, focusing on base markets. In 2025, it will primarily target six key base markets (Suining, Chengdu, Mianyang, Liaocheng, Dezhou, Tianjin) with significant investments in channel construction and consumer engagement [2] - The company aims to increase its e-commerce share over the next two years through differentiated products and marketing strategies [2] Recent Operational Feedback - The company has seen a notable recovery in sales, with improved performance in key products like Shezhidao and T68. The opening rate has significantly improved from a large decline in June to positive growth in August [3] - Increased investments in banquet markets and expansion into township markets are ongoing, along with enhancements in group purchasing channels. The company is also streamlining its internal organization to improve execution and communication [3] Future Outlook - The company is focused on long-term strategies, concentrating on four core products and innovating cultural products for younger demographics. It plans to enhance brand influence and find growth in existing markets while adhering to its strategy of "downward channels, upward brands, and comprehensive focus on consumers" [3] - The company anticipates a gradual recovery in consumer spending, which will positively impact sales and profitability [3] Profit Forecast and Valuation - The company maintains revenue projections for 2025-2027 at 4.69 billion, 4.90 billion, and 5.21 billion yuan, with year-on-year changes of -12.5%, +4.5%, and +6.4% respectively. EPS estimates for the same period are 1.47, 1.57, and 1.71 yuan [4] - The company is assigned a target price of 79.42 yuan based on a 54x PE ratio for 2025, maintaining a "buy" rating [4]
